The future is looking quite bright for the Valiant Universe, and the company hopes to keep the momentum going with an expansion into other digital mediums. That includes the much talked about X-O Manowar feature that is in active development, and while there are no official announcements regarding the project, we might have a better idea now as to who will be sitting in the director's chairs.

CEO and chief creative officer at Valiant Entertainment Dinesh Shamdasani recently spoke to Variant Comics about where Valiant, and specifically X-O Manowar, is looking to expand from here. He detailed the future of X-O's book first.

"X-O's got a very very bright future. Not only are we hitting X-O Manowar #50, which is this massive run not just for X-O Manowar but for anybody today in modern comics. There's only a few characters, Batman is one of the only other characters that I can think of that's had or even approaching a run like this in the modern era."

Their foothold will remain in the comics where their success began, but they are looking to take advantage of their iconic characters, and fans will see X-O Manowar

"We always will be a comic book publisher, that's where our core is, but the nature of the beast now is these other avenues are there and it's a way for us to touch more people and bring them into comics and so we have a bunch of big video game news coming that I can't tell you about. We've got some live-action content that I can't tell you about, and we've got movies that I can't tell you about, but I can say that I wish that the directors on X-O Manowar would leak so that I could talk about them, because not only are they mind-blowingly awesome, the things they're doing with X-O Manowar will make fanboy heads explode. It's some really cool stuff, but I can't say any more than that.

Notice he said "directors" and then reiterated the point when he said "them". That automatically brings up names like the Wachowski's (Sense8), the Russo brothers (Avengers: Infinity War), the team of Phil Lord and Christopher Miller (The LEGO Movie), and even the slight possibility of someone like the Coen's (Fargo). If the field has to be narrowed down, the Wachowski's and the Russo's seem like the best fits for the character and the universe as a whole, and both would certainly bring a unique flavor to Valiant's flagship character.
